Two people swept under bridge

Update: 12.17PM Two people who are believed to have been swept into the current underneath Maungatapu Bridge are now ashore.

A dog is safely back to shore. Photos: Cameron Avery.

Northern Fire Communications shift manager Jarron Phillips confirmed two people were in the water.

He says Tauranga and Greerton fire brigades attended.

"A firefighter ended up going out on a surfboard and another firefighter went out on a kayak."

Tauranga Coastguard operations manager Simon Barker says they were called but were stood down.

Earlier report:

A reporter at the scene says two people and a dog have made it to shallow water. "The dog was swimming in the water for a while." A kayaker is with them.

A caller to 0800SUNLIVE says St John Ambulance and police are at the scene. A rescue helicopter is also on scene.
